New Walmart provides approximately 230 jobs, plus savings on wide selection of merchandise

BEVERLY HILLS, Fla., Jan. 16, 2013 - Residents of Beverly Hills are invited to the new Walmart store, which opens on Wednesday, Jan. 23, at 1936 N.  Lecanto Highway. The grand opening is scheduled for 7:30 a.m., and the store will open to the public immediately following the grand-opening ceremony. The new store brings approximately 230 new jobs to the area and opportunities for savings for customers. It will be open 24 hours per day, seven days a week.

Ribbon-Cutting Celebration at 7:30 a.m., Wednesday, Jan. 23
Community and business leaders will join Walmart associates at 7:30 a.m., Wednesday, Jan. 23, for a brief ribbon-cutting ceremony.  The national anthem will be performed by members of the Lecanto High School Band and the posting of colors by members of Lecanto High School.

Community Organizations Benefit from Grand-Opening Grants
Nonprofit organizations will also benefit from the retailer's ongoing charitable contributions and support for community projects. As part of Walmart's commitment to the communities in which it operates, $6,000 in grants from Walmart and the Walmart Foundation will be presented throughout the year. The Crest Elementary School will receive a $2,000 grant and a donation of two Walmart trailers of food will be made to the We Care Food Pantry.

Healthier Food and "Great For You"
Walmart made a major commitment to make food healthier and healthier food more affordable, ensuring families won't have to choose between a product that is good for them and one they can afford. Steps in the healthier food initiative include:

  • Reformulate thousands of packaged food items by 2015 by reducing sodium and added sugars and removing all remaining industrially produced trans fats.
  • Make healthier choices more affordable by providing savings on fresh produce and reducing the price premium on "better-for-you" items.
  • Provide solutions to address food deserts by bringing stores in underserved communities.
  • Increase charitable support for nutrition programs that help educate consumers about healthier food solutions and choices.

The "Great For You" icon appears on select Great Value and Marketside products as well as fresh and packaged fruits and vegetables. The icon was developed to help customers easily identify nutritious food options so they can make healthier eating choices for themselves and their families.
